ANALYSIS
Australia has more than 140000 retail organizations in the
country.
The number of transitional retail stores are higher than
online stores
The online retail market of this country represents 6% of
total retail sales.
More than 200000 people are working in Australian retail
Industry
Total value of the retail industry in financial year 2010 was
$215 billion.

ANALYSIS
India has more than 14 million retail outlets in the country.
More than 40 million people are directly or indirectly working in
this industry.
51% of this industry are controlled by the foreign retailers.
Total value of this industry is about $600 billion.
The growth of Indian retail market is higher due to excess demand.
